As soon as it is > implemented & tested, we can say that both is supported :) Bindings are not supposed to be limited by the existing driver implementation, so you can already allow both polarities, and just reject the unsupported options in the driver at probe time. Future updates to the driver won't require a binding change. -- Regards, Laurent Pinchart
